She is a multiple Dutch champion in this discipline and has represented the Netherlands several times in the European and World championships.
[1] Turpijn made her breakthrough in 2007 by becoming the Dutch MTB National Champion in both Marathon and Cross Country (XC).
She started that year at the European Cross Country championship in Fort William, Scotland, but didn't achieve a significant result due to equipment failure.
In 2011 she came 6th in the European Marathon championship in Kleinzell, Austria, over 21 minutes behind to winner Pia Sundstedt from Finland.
In 2011 and 2013, Turpijn was named Dutch Female MTB rider of the year in an award presented by Club van 5.
